WebbGradually begin to adjust your breathing so your exhale becomes equal to, and then longer than your inhale. First, get into the rhythm of 2 counts breathing in, and 4 counts breathing out. Once you get the hang of it, try 3 in, and 6 out. (That’s my personal preference for this exercise—some people prefer 6 and 12.)
